What Is Major Depressive Disorder?

Depression is a mental disorder that leads to prolonged periods of sadness, loss of interest in activities, and altered thinking and behavior. As opposed to transient fluctuations in one’s mood, depression may persist for weeks or months and impair an individual’s functioning at work and in personal matters.

Timely intervention and appropriate coping mechanisms may increase the quality of one’s life and decrease the likelihood of further occurrences.

Common Symptoms of Major Depressive Disorder

Symptoms may vary from person to person, but common signs include:

  • Feeling sad or empty most of the day
  • Losing interest in hobbies and activities
  • Low energy and constant tiredness
  • Difficulty sleeping or sleeping too much
  • Changes in appetite or weight
  • Trouble concentrating
  • Feeling hopeless or worthless
  • Moving or speaking more slowly
  • Thoughts of self-harm or suicide in severe cases

If these symptoms continue for more than two weeks, it is important to speak with a healthcare professional.

1. Exercise Every Day

Regular physical activity is one of the most effective natural ways to support mental health.

Benefits include:

  • Increases natural mood-boosting chemicals
  • Reduces stress hormones
  • Improves sleep quality
  • Builds confidence
  • Boosts overall energy

Walking, cycling, swimming, yoga, or light strength training for at least 30 minutes most days can improve emotional health.

2. Eat a Balanced Diet

The brain needs proper nutrition to function well.

Choose foods like:

  • Fresh fruits
  • Vegetables
  • Whole grains
  • Nuts and seeds
  • Fish rich in healthy fats
  • Beans and legumes

Limit processed foods, sugary snacks, and excessive fast food because they may negatively affect mood and energy levels.

3. Improve Sleep Quality

Poor sleep can make depression worse.

Healthy sleep habits include:

  • Going to bed at the same time every night
  • Limiting screen time before sleep
  • Keeping the bedroom quiet and dark
  • Avoiding caffeine late in the day
  • Creating a relaxing bedtime routine

Adults should aim for 7–9 hours of quality sleep each night.

4. Practice Mindfulness and Meditation

Mindfulness helps people focus on the present instead of worrying about the past or future.

Daily meditation may help:

  • Lower anxiety
  • Reduce negative thinking
  • Improve emotional balance
  • Increase self-awareness
  • Support better stress management

Even ten minutes each day can provide noticeable benefits over time.

5. Stay Connected With Others

Depression often causes people to withdraw from family and friends.

Strong social support can:

  • Reduce feelings of loneliness
  • Provide emotional comfort
  • Encourage healthy habits
  • Improve motivation
  • Help during difficult times

Talking openly with trusted people is an important step toward recovery.

6. Spend Time Outdoors

Nature has a calming effect on the mind.

Benefits of spending time outside include:

  • Better mood
  • Reduced stress
  • More physical activity
  • Improved focus
  • Higher vitamin D levels through safe sunlight exposure

Even a short walk in a local park can improve emotional well-being.

7. Manage Daily Stress

Long-term stress increases the risk of depression and makes symptoms harder to manage.

Helpful stress management techniques include:

  • Deep breathing
  • Gentle stretching
  • Journaling
  • Listening to calming music
  • Taking regular breaks from work

Learning healthy coping skills helps reduce emotional pressure.

8. Set Small Daily Goals

Depression can make simple tasks feel overwhelming.

Instead of trying to do everything at once:

  • Make a small to-do list
  • Complete one task at a time
  • Celebrate small achievements
  • Maintain a simple daily routine

Small successes build confidence and improve motivation.

9. Avoid Alcohol and Recreational Drugs

Many people believe alcohol helps them relax, but it often makes depression worse.

Avoiding alcohol and recreational drugs helps:

  • Improve emotional stability
  • Support healthy sleep
  • Increase treatment success
  • Reduce mood swings

Healthy coping methods provide much better long-term results.

When Should You See a Doctor?

Seek medical help if:

  • Symptoms last longer than two weeks
  • Depression affects work or family life
  • Daily activities become difficult
  • You lose interest in everything
  • Thoughts of self-harm occur

Early treatment often leads to better recovery.
